## Session Handling: Lexiscan String Extraction

The Lexiscan script pulls translatable strings from all Fernwheel frontends nightly. Each run opens a short-lived session against the strings service; sessions expire after 15 minutes, so long extractions must refresh midway. Support staff re-running a failed job should verify the session was renewed before filing escalations. Manual runs against the staging endpoint must include the bearer token shown below.

session JWT of yawep-yawep = eyJhbGciOiJIUzI1NiIsInR5cCI6IkpXVCJ9.eyJzdWIiOiI3pWF3_In0.aXYsHiog

## Log Sampling: Burrowd

Burrowd emits ~40k lines/min at peak. We sample at 1:100 for INFO, keep all WARN and above. Sampling config lives in the Lanternfall repo under `burrowd/sampling.yaml`. Changes deploy on merge; no restart needed. If you need full-fidelity logs for an incident, flip the override flag for max 2 hours. Questions on sampling ratios or retention go to the observability crew.

escalation mailbox, bafog-fafog: ulador@paliqlabs.internal

Ticket: TumbleNest laundry-locker access flow fails when a resident scans within the five-second door-relock window. The app reports success, but the locker controller rejects the command silently, leaving garments inaccessible until staff override. Expected behavior: queue the unlock and retry once the relock completes. Steps to reproduce and controller logs are attached. When investigating, please reference the trace identifier recorded below.

build token for kagaf-hahof: htk14_9d3d4d26d7d8de

## Load Testing the Checkout Flow

Plugin authors validating against the Cartfell checkout sandbox should run the bundled load harness before submitting. The harness ramps synthetic shoppers through cart, payment, and confirmation stages and reports per-stage latency. Throttle limits in the sandbox are lower than production, so tune your plugin accordingly. The harness reads its settings from the environment, and the defaults it ships with appear below.

deployment values, kahof-yadug:
[gorys]
team = silael
access_code = ac_00d620
owner = istox.oliys
host = gorys.torvastack.example
port = 9000
peer = holmir.merlaqsoft.example
salt = 9fdae78a
pin = 2358